Export Google Search Console Data to Sheets

Automates pulling Search Console metrics like keywords, clicks, impressions, CTR, and positions into Google Sheets for effortless SEO tracking and visualization without manual logins.

This n8n workflow fetches performance data from Google Search Console via API, including keywords, pages, clicks, impressions, CTR, and average positions, then exports it directly to a Google Sheets document. It runs on a customizable schedule, allowing users to set their domain and date ranges for targeted queries. How to import this workflow into n8n

  1. 1Purchase or download the workflow to get the n8n workflow JSON file.
  2. 2In your n8n instance, open Workflows and choose "Import from File" (or paste the JSON with Ctrl+V on the canvas).
  3. 3Open each node marked with a credential warning and connect your own accounts and API keys.
  4. 4Run the workflow once manually to verify the data flow, then toggle it to Active.
